Baseball: MP, DV to face off as region foes for final time

Comments 0 | Recommend 0

ahwatukee.com

A baseball era will come to a close Wednesday afternoon.

After an 11-year rivalry, Mountain Pointe and Desert Vista will face each other for the final time in region play on the baseball diamond at Mountain Pointe.

Next season, and for at least the following one, Desert Vista will remain in the Central Region with Brophy, Chandler, Chandler Hamilton, Mesa and Mesa Red Mountain.

Mountain Pointe moves over to the new Pima Region with Casa Grande, Marcos de Niza, Chandler Perry and Mesa Desert Ridge, Skyline and Westwood.

It was a rare season when Desert Vista or Mountain Pointe dominated the other in the regular season and just as rare when one team would sweep the other in the regular season, three-game home-and-home series.

Desert Vista has a 2-0 edge over the Pride going into the regular season finale.

The last time one school swept the other was two years ago when Mountain Pointe won all three games then lost to Desert Vista in the double-elimination playoffs.

This season Desert Vista is the third seed among the state's top 16 teams that qualify for a playoff spot while Mountain Pointe is hoping for a win over the Thunder and a miracle to help move them up from the 19th spot and at least a position near the bubble.

Game time is scheduled for 4 p.m.
